Description: Affidavit of George Spann, from Montgomery County, Georgia, dated October 3, 1800, sworn to before Justice of the Peace Horatio Marbury. Spann testifies that he apprehended a slave named Bob who told him that he had come from the Chehaw Town in the Creek Nation. Bob was then stolen from Spann by John Ford and James Adamson. It is unclear why or how Bob left the Creek Nation.
